WebThe Diffie-Hellman algorithm uses exponential calculations to arrive at the same premaster secret. The server and client each provide a parameter for the calculation, and when combined they result in a different calculation on each side, with results that are equal. WebNov 26, 2012 · Notice they did the same calculation with the exponents in a different order. When you flip the exponent, the result doesn't change. So they both calculated three raised to the power of their private numbers. WebMay 1, 2024 · Because Diffie-Hellman always uses new random values for each session, (therefore generating new keys for each session) it is called Ephemeral Diffie Hellman (EDH or DHE). Many cipher suites use this to achieve perfect forward secrecy.
